How long does it take to cook beans in a pressure cooker?

Black beans: 20 to 25 minutes. Black-eyed peas : 20 to 25 minutes. Great Northern beans: 25 to 30 minutes. Navy beans: 25 to 30 minutes.

How do you cook dried beans in a stovetop pressure cooker?

Place seasoning and beans in pressure cooker. Cover with about 1 1/2 inches of hot water over the level of the beans. Be sure to not fill the cooker over half way. Cook for 22 to 30 minutes, depending on the variety.

How long does it take to cook soaked beans in a pressure cooker?

Pressure cook on high pressure: 30 minutes for unsoaked beans or 15 minutes for soaked beans. Let the Instant Pot natural release for 15 minutes. Quick release any remaining pressure.
